js插入html頁面(js 添加html代碼)
1想問問JS代碼能支持WAP網(wǎng)站的html瀏覽嗎?2我想講這段JS代碼加入到我的HTML代碼中在WAP中詳細(xì)我有很多HTML文件如1html2html3html等等我想點擊JS代碼中的下一頁進(jìn)能 1想問問JS代碼能支持WAP網(wǎng)站的html瀏覽;ltscript 2 定義專門的外部文件 將JavaScript代碼寫在一個獨立的腳本文件擴(kuò)展名為js中,在頁面中使用時直接導(dǎo)入該腳本文件即可,導(dǎo)入的格式ltscript type=quottextjavascriptquot src=quot要導(dǎo)入的js文件jsquotltscript。
4然后,我們通過快捷鍵Ctrl+F快速定位到我們需要修改的位置5回到html文件,在按鈕輸入框后面創(chuàng)建一個script標(biāo)簽,然后添加用來引入addJsjs文件的addJs事件6保存html文件后使用瀏覽器打開,點擊按鈕即可看到;js文件不是htm文件,所以里面不能有html標(biāo)記在輸出語句中包含的html標(biāo)記除外即使js文件中可以用ltscript標(biāo)記,由于js文件本身就是由ltscript src=quotquot標(biāo)記調(diào)用的,這就變成重復(fù)標(biāo)記了,是畫蛇添足了js屬于腳本。
js 添加html代碼
documentreadyfunction $quot#btnquotclickfunction $#39#newDiv#39load#39newhtml#39 點擊“新頁面”即可實現(xiàn)添加 2,基于純js代碼實現(xiàn)嵌套html代碼ltbutton type=quotbuttonquot id=quotbt。
HTML頁面里想要插入js需要使用script標(biāo)簽在一對script標(biāo)簽中間寫你想要插入的js代碼就行,而這一對script標(biāo)簽可以放到head之間,也可以放到body之間,這是直接在頁面寫的方法,另一種方法是引入外部的js文件,同樣使用script。
嵌入javaScript有兩種書寫方式1內(nèi)部js 11在script中編寫 ltscript type=quottextjavascriptquot function showOutter 通過id,獲得輸入內(nèi)容 var content = documentgetElementByIdquotcontentquotvaluealertcontent。
新建一網(wǎng)頁文件“samplehtmlquot,用記事本或其它文本編輯軟件如UltraEdit打開,輸入HTML代碼該網(wǎng)頁文件包括一個藍(lán)色的字符串,一個按鈕和一個文本框JS代碼可插入到”headquot標(biāo)簽之間編寫Javascript代碼,代碼內(nèi)容,并將該;forlet i=0iltdocumentgetElementsByTagNamequotquotlengthi++ documentgetElementsByTagNamequotdivquotistylebackgroundImage=quoturl#39#39quot 在tagname方法里傳你要修改的html元素標(biāo)簽名,url那里寫上圖片的地址。
我的經(jīng)驗是,直接把 HTML 單獨寫到一個瀏覽器能訪問到的文件里,比如 templatefoohtml然后 JS 里發(fā)一個同步 XHR 請求去讀這個文件,例如var html = Templateload#39templatefoohtml#39var target = document;1將你的廣告代碼保存為ADjs文件,路徑任意,假設(shè)你保存在C盤根目錄下2在html文件中找到ltheadlthead標(biāo)簽,并在中間添加如下代碼ltscript language=quotjavascriptquot src=quotCADjsquot 這樣就可以了。
所謂動態(tài)寫入方法就是源文件代碼中原來沒有內(nèi)容或者需要重新改變此處的要顯示的文字或內(nèi)容,需要用JavaScript代碼來實現(xiàn)動態(tài)寫入是一種很常見常用的方法1用innerHTML寫入html代碼ltdiv id=quotabcquotltdiv ltscript;1打開編輯器,新建testhtml,用于學(xué)習(xí)今天的內(nèi)容2接下來需要在head標(biāo)簽下方引入插件3在頁面的body標(biāo)簽里,新建一個p,名稱為test4在body標(biāo)簽下方寫上scriptscript,用來存放js代碼通過class。
#39#login#39loadquottexthtmlquot 就可以了,或者 var test=quottexthtmlquotalerttest#39#login#39loadtest;在JS中插入短的HTML代碼,可以通過先使用一個函數(shù)來包著,你要添加的HTMl代碼,然后在使用innerHTML這個函數(shù)提取就行,在你的HTMl中添加一個事件就行,然后調(diào)用這個函數(shù)就行了,具體的我提供例子給你看下lthtml lthead。
掃描二維碼推送至手機(jī)訪問。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請注明出處。